Among biological scientists, there are lumpers and there are splitters. Lumpers like things organized together under fewer categories. Splitters like to make new categories for minute differences in common things.
I'm a lumper. In forums, I like all my info together in one big thread, rather than dozens of like threads with similar titles. With lumping, it's easy to find a useful thread and return to it over and over, and add to its value.
In any case, I'd encourage us to add our info to older threads that are well-titled and full of great details. For whatever my opinion is worth.
